GeForce RTX 3080 outperforms Radeon RX 6700 XT by a significant 38% based on our aggregate benchmark results.

Summary

We compared two graphics cards: the Radeon RX 6700 XT with 12GB VRAM (RDNA 3 architecture), against the GeForce RTX 3080 with 10GB VRAM (Ampere architecture). Both graphics cards offer competitive value for their respective price points. The Radeon RX 6700 XT is more power-efficient, consuming 230W compared to 320W.
